Skill-gated examine

This was inspired by this thread here: https://sindome.org/bgbb/open-discussion/anything-really/how-to-character-creation-without-tears-1328/ and I admittedly don't know the feasibility of it, but, thought it might potentially be a bridge over knowledge gap.

Maybe have some commands for items listed under examine gated by the skill the examining character has in the appropriate skill. Or helpfiles gated similarly, to avoid a bottleneck of knowledge that a character should possess even if their player is brand new to the game.

There's some skills where if you examine an item, it can show you some commands that are gated by skill. Namely crafting commands (help crafting)
I'm kinda confused what you're suggesting here. Are you suggesting that some commands should be completely hidden if you don't have the relevant skills? If so, I'm very, very against this idea.
examine and inspect already changed based off what you're looking at and your skills, i also don't know what you're suggesting here
More the opposite, in the thread people were talking about how people take skills but don't know necessarily what can be done with it and that is why mentors are "necessary" for some of them. But the mentors and the interested people might not be on the same schedule, may have burned out, that sort of a deal, so at least having it available in another form would help while not just opening the flood gates like some seemed concerned about.
